what you need to make them:

mini chocolate donuts(store bought or home made)

yellow M&Ms(I used the light yellow Easter ones)

orange or pink heart sprinkles

black food writing pen

frosting or melted chocolate

Add a little bit of frosting or melted chocolate to the top of the donuts. I had frosting on hand so I used that but melted chocolate might be easier. Take a yellow M&M, put a dab of frosting or chocolate towards the bottom middle.

Take a black food writer and draw two half circles facing down for the eyes. You could also just put two dots for the eyes. Then put the M&Ms on the donuts.

How to Care for your new baby chickens in Chignik Lagoon, Alaska Baby chicks are quite cute as well as challenging to withstand, however it's best to prepare for their arrival prior to you obtain them. Prepare initially by gathering not just the correct materials, yet likewise the appropriate knowledge to look after them. Raising baby chicks is fairly easy, you merely have to provide them with the following: A clean and cozy environment Lots of food and water Interest and love Habitat Your environment could be a simple box, aquarium, pet cat provider, or guinea porker cage. Line it with old towels as well as blankets (without loose strings!) to start, as well as after a couple of weeks use straw over paper. Keep in mind: Avoid making use of only paper or various other slipper surface areas-- or your chicks legs could expand malformed. You additionally need something to dish out food and also water in, such as a chicken feeder as well as water recipe from the feed store, or a pickle container cover for food and also a pet bird water dispenser from an animal store. Additionally, as the chicks age you can introduce a perch right into the environment to get them educated on perching. Heat To keep your chicks warm you need to provide them with a heat resource. This could be as basic as a 100 watt light bulb in a reflective clamp style lamp from an equipment shop, or an infrared reptile heat bulb additionally work very well (my recommendation). Chicks require this heat 24/7 up until their downy fluff is replaced with feathers (which could occupy to two months). The recently hatched require a temperature in between 90 and also 100 degrees, as well as weekly this could be minimized by about 5 levels approximately. The warmth resource need to get on merely one side of the cage to permit chicks a range of temperature levels. The chicks are your best thermometer- if they are concealing in the contrary edge of your heat lamp, you have to reduce the temperature. If they are smothering each other under the heat (not just snuggling), you should put some warmth. Housekeeping Tidiness is key and also it keeps your chicks healthy. Make sure to change the bed linens commonly as well as constantly supply tidy food and water Food and water. Chicks expand extremely fast which calls for lots of tidy food and also water. Offer enough at all times as well as examine frequently to avoid thirsty and also starving chicks. Chick food is different than adult chicken food, and also it can be found in both medicated and also non-medicated selections. Feed chick food for the very first two months, after that change to a grower food (~ 17 % protein) for one more 2 months, and after that to a somewhat lower healthy protein feed or a level feed (if you have layers). Soil Some chicks prefer to obtain a running start on taking filth bathrooms, while others won't occupy that task till they are older. If you have the space in your chick unit, present a tray of sand or dirt for them to shower in. Attention and also love There are a couple of benefits to spending quality time with your chicks. To start with, they will more than likely bond with you and also not escape as grownups. Second, if you analyze your chicks daily as well as view their behavior, you can catch health problem or various other problems earlier. Keep an eye out for wheezing, hopping, or various other undesirable signs. Make certain to also consider their poop, as looseness of the bowels could lead to matted feathers and also obstructed cloaca. Last but not least, it is necessary to watch out for social concerns, such as the smallest chick getting picked on.
